Engagement Manager – Managed Solutions – HYBRID
The TSG Engagement Management team provides dedicated customer and consultant relationship support for multiple on-going projects.
Engagement manager for simultaneous, solutions-based service engagements. Responsible for monitoring project scope, schedule, deliverables, budget, quality, and resources. Manage day-to-day responsibilities of resources at client site to ensure alignment with customer expectations. Partner with internal teams to ensure service quality during and upon completion of an engagement. This is a HYBRID role, and will require travel into the clients Houston office 2-3x a week

Responsibilities:
Service Delivery and Quality
- Serve as customer escalation point for issues/concerns regarding project status and service delivery; provide status reports to client management, as needed.
- Responsible for oversight of consultants during project engagement. Serve as project team resource manager accountable for daily activities of consultant and team. Responsible for ensuring team is trained on relevant project processes, tools, or methodologies.
- Resolve resource issues in a timely manner; provide coaching & management, escalate any performance concerns to management and human resources.
Project Management
- Monitor performance of the project via various reporting tools (e.g., identify areas of risk and concern, recommends solution and appropriate course of action, etc.). Conduct periodic project reviews to determine compliance with contractual obligations, delivery commitments, and client satisfaction.
- Responsible for transmitting information related to project scope changes (approved change orders, staffing changes, end date extensions, etc.)
- Translate engagement scope into work plans describing engagement tasks, timing, and responsibilities.
- Develop internal and external status reports utilizing established formats.
- Communicate updates and changes to the appropriate teams.
Key Skills:
- Self-starter or ability to take initiative
- Organized with keen attention to details
- Problem solving and critical thinking
- Effective verbal and written communication
- Deliver on multiple projects simultaneously
- Basic knowledge and use of Microsoft Suite (Excel, Powerpoint, Sharepoint)
Requirements:
- 2-5 years of project coordination/management or people management experience
- 6+ months of experience in a customer facing role
- 4-year degree at accredited College (or equivalent business experience)
